James Sheward Joins Eastern Technology Council Board of DirectorsBLUE BELL, Pa. and WAYNE, Pa. – Oct. 31 , 2005 – Fiberlink Communications Corp., a leading innovator and trusted enterprise partner for secure mobile workforce solutions, and the Eastern Technology Council today announced that James Sheward, chief executive officer, co-founder and director of Fiberlink, has joined the Eastern Technology Council’s Board of Directors. Eastern Technology Council board members are responsible for: developing the Council’s yearly agenda, proposing new activities and promotions to further the Council’s initiatives, actively promoting the Council to members, supporting organizations and media, and campaigning for new members and financial support for the Council. Mr. Sheward has join ed the Eastern Technology Council’s board as a technology representative from the region , and an expert in securing the mobile workforce and corporate networks. He will leverage his experiences at Fiberlink to assist the Eastern Technology Council with its active participation with members in the regional technology community and pursue continued growth. “I am delighted to have Jim Sheward join our Board of Directors,” stated Dianne Strunk, chief executive officer of the Eastern Technology Council. “His extensive leadership expertise will help us tremendously as we continue to grow and meet the needs of our members.” Mr. Sheward looks forward to joining the Eastern Technology Council’s board and commented, “The ETC is an incredibly valuable asset for the region and I am pleased to be involved with the organization having been an active member for a number of years.” Mr. Sheward co-founded Fiberlink with company chairman, Paul Russell, in 1994. Since then, the company has grown to be a leader in the mobile enterprise network services industry, employing over 200 people in the Philadelphia region. Mr. Sheward’s success hasn’t gone unnoticed. He was the winner of the Blue Chip Enterprise Award Year 2000, sponsored by the U.S. Chamber of Commerce and Mass Mutual Financial Group, and has been recognized as Greater Philadelphia’s 2001 Ernst & Young Entrepreneur of the Year in the Software and Technology Services Category. In May 2004, Jim and Co-Founder Paul Russell received “Innovator of the Year” awards from Temple University’s Fox School of Business.
